Gallienus. AD 253-268. Antoninianus (21mm, 3.52 g, 1h). Mediolanum (Milan) mint, 2nd officina. Issue 7, AD 266. IMP GALLIENVS P AVG, radiate bust left in consular robe, holding eagle-tipped sceptre / FORTVNA REDVX, Fortuna seated left, holding rudder and cornucopiae; · S [·] M · in exergue. MIR 36, 1349m; RIC V (sole reign) 482 var. (bust type and officina mark); Cunetio –. Near VF, rough brown surfaces. Extremely rare, only one piece noted by MIR (in Karlsruhe).


Bought from Manton Associates, 1992.
